Hadamard Matrix - Practical Applications

Practical Applications

  • Olivia MFSK – an amateur-radio digital protocol designed to work in difficult (low signal-to-noise ratio plus multipath propagation) conditions on shortwave bands.
  • Balanced Repeated Replication (BRR) – a technique used by statisticians to estimate the variance of a statistical estimator.
  • Coded aperture spectrometry – an instrument for measuring the spectrum of light. The mask element used in coded aperture spectrometers is often a variant of a Hadamard matrix.
  • Feedback Delay Networks – Digital reverberation devices which use Hadamard matrices to blend sample values
  • Plackett–Burman design of experiments for investigating the dependence of some measured quantity on a number of independent variables.
